Inclusion criteria

Inclusion criteria: - apparently healthy (self-indicated); - adolescents 12-17 years of age; - adults 18-65 years of age.

Exclusion criteria

Exclusion criteria: - adults with a BMI 30; - pregnancy; - having self-indicated claustrophobia or respiratory problems e.g. due to a common cold; - having a pacemaker; - participating in other scientific research.

Design outcomes

Primary

MeasureTime frame
The main study parameters are the VO2 (ml/min), VCO2 (ml/min) and RQ which are measured with alternating use by the indirect calorimeters. These parameters make it possible to calculate REE (MJ/day), which is the primary endpoint.

Secondary

MeasureTime frame
The parameters weight (kg), height (m), and body mass index (BMI, kg/m2) are measured by scale and stadiometer. With these parameters the REE (MJ/day) can be derived using the prediction equations. The predicted REEs are compared with the measured REEs.
